You asked for feedback. Here's some things I think could be better: 1. The volume could be louder. Its easier for those who want quiet to turn it down than for those who want louder to turn it up. I have it at full volume but don't feel "engulfed" in the sound, by the room, or experience. 2. The EQ is very brittle. It sounds like you could use some more low end, and even a little more mid. But definitely more bass. 3. I don't know if you're using noise reduction software or not, but it sounds like the very high end is being stifled by something. Maybe it's just your mics. Noise reduction kills ASMR frequencies. Some white noise is okay anyway. If it's too bad, you can usually find the cause to be electrical: i.e. crossed wires, cables not grounded, faulty USB, etc. Try to keep things that emit electromagnetic waves (electricity or light) away from cables that transfer sound (mic cable and/preamp cable) and speaker cables. There's a lot of studio tutorials on wiring that boost recording quality and eliminate unwanted feedback online. hope this helps.

I see. It's always hard with things like cars and other ambient noises. Some people don't like them, while others prefer them for a more realistic experience. I, for one, do not mind if they're not overly intrusive. As for the white noise, you already noticed that noise removal makes you sound robotic. A lot of ASMR artists don't and it ruins it. As I said, anything in the electromagnetic spectrum can interfere with audio signals. Even though they all wrapped in chords, some of the energy escapes these chords. While it's not dangerous to humans, something as sensitive as audio recording cables will definitely pick it up. When I worked in a studio, that was the biggest thing was to keep all the wires neat and organized, and each type of wire away from another. So all power chords in one group, all aux chords in another, all USB in another, etc. Sometimes I would get a lot of white noise between my MBox (I/O box for Pro Tools) and the PC and realized it was just a shitty USB chord. Try to get all your accessories from a good audio dealer. Noise removal was created for music, typically. All of the analog equipment, instruments, etc. had tiny bits of white noise that, when combined, wound add up to a bunch of white noise. And so mastering engineers would carefully remove as much as they can. But now with most plugins being digital, most of the problems with noise can be solved without noise removal.
